Buckle up, friends. Idaho Police will be looking for the seat belt-less drivers (and passengers) through the month of May. If you're caught, you will be fined.

If you're thinking of not wearing your seat belt, set aside around $69 per violation. Each person in the car needs to be properly restrained, no matter where they are seated. Fines for violating this law range from $10 to $69. The campaign goes from now until May 30.
